Pattaya: A third-place finish at the 2017 Beach Soccer World Cup and the recent capture of the 2018 Beach Soccer Intercontinental Cup title underline Islamic Republic of Iran's credentials as one of the world's strongest teams, but head coach Marco Octavio insists nothing will be taken for granted in their opening AFC Beach Soccer Championship Thailand 2019 match against Iraq.
With a legion of stars including Mohammad Masoumizadeh and Mohammad Ali Mokhtari at their disposal, the reigning champions are among the favourites to claim the title on March 17, but Ocatvio knows there are countless examples of highly-favoured teams coming unstuck and urged his players to perform from day one.
"Two days ago we saw Real Madrid lost at home, and we had an experience in my country Brazil, where we lost a (FIFA) World Cup semi-final 7-1 as favourites (against Germany in 2014)," he said.
